To address excessive inward rolling of the foot, which puts extra pressure on the ankles (a condition called overpronation), these sneakers have a premium insole with an anatomical shape that provides vital arch support. This support helps maintain proper foot and ankle alignment, preventing excessive strain on the plantar fascia and reducing the risk of overworking or damaging it.

Probably the most important feature of these sneakers, perfect for the elderly, is their slip-on design. They are the ideal choice for individuals who may have difficulty bending over, dealing with laces, or have any other mobility issues.

The innovative hands-free design eliminates the need for traditional laces by incorporating a discreet spring mechanism in the back section. This mechanism allows the rear portion of the shoe to gently descend as the foot enters, making it easy to slide the foot in and ensuring a secure fit as the shoe promptly rebounds and embraces the foot.

What is Ankle Support in Shoes?

The best shoes for ankle support are those that fit you well and come with enhanced support in the midsole, a cushioned insole, a deep heel cup, a higher heel drop, arch support, and a wide toe box.
